Overview
TaeKwon Kids are practitioners of the art of Taekwon-Do. They forego the use of weapons and instead specialize in various kicks. Their equipment is limited to equips that all jobs except novices use. However, there are a few exceptions to this rule (i.e. Manteaus and Boots can be equipped by them). Taekwons, Star Gladiator, and Soul Linker share a unique level-up angel that provides level 10 Blessing and Increase AGI for 10 minutes with each base level.

HappinessHappiness is a special status achievable by Taekwon-class characters sitting beside each other and using the /doridori emote. It has no intrinsic bonuses, but entering it can wipe a Star Gladiator's Solar, Lunar, and Stellar designations. Also, the skill Happy Break gives a high chance of Earth Spike scrolls not being consumed when used.
